Tomorrow is the first round of the Birthday Cup and is to be played as Foursomes with scoring in the stableford format. The brief rules for this are:
Foursomes is played with a partner but playing only one ball and taking alternate shots. Each person tees off on alternate holes irrespective of who holes out on the previous hole. Both course handicaps are added together and then divided by two to find the pair's playing handicap. Half shots are rounded up.
